A slotless ac motor structure based on a few iron cores

This utility model discloses a slotless AC motor structure based on a reduced-core design, comprising a housing, a stator module, a partial core module, and a rotor module. The housing includes a main body and a base plate. The stator module is built into the housing and includes an annular non-magnetic frame and coils. The partial core module includes several cores, which are mounted one-to-one on a core mounting bracket, with air gaps between adjacent cores. This slotless AC motor structure aims to solve problems such as significant cogging effect, excessive core weight, and inflexible magnetic circuit in traditional motor structures. The motor eliminates the traditional slotted stator structure, adopting a combination design of slotless coils and a partial magnetic core. While ensuring effective control of the magnetic flux path, it significantly reduces motor weight, manufacturing complexity, and improves dynamic response performance.

Novel knuckle bearing V-shaped pusher

The utility model relates to automobile parts, and provides a novel knuckle bearing V pusher which comprises a first connecting rod, a second connecting rod, a V-end ball head sub assembly, a first ball pin sub assembly and a second ball pin sub assembly, and the V-end ball head sub assembly comprises a mounting seat, a ball head, a metal bearing outer ring, a ball seat and an end cover. A containing cavity between the ball seat and the end cover and a containing cavity between the ball seat and the installation seat are both filled with lubricating grease, a first spiral oil channel and a second spiral oil channel are formed in the inner wall of the metal bearing outer ring, and an oil channel inlet of the first spiral oil channel is communicated with the lubricating grease in the containing cavity between the ball seat and the end cover. An oil duct inlet of the second spiral oil duct is communicated with lubricating grease in a containing cavity between the ball seat and the mounting seat, and an oil duct outlet of the first spiral oil duct and an oil duct outlet of the second spiral oil duct are both located in a bearing contact area between the metal bearing outer ring and the ball head. The problems that an existing thrust rod assembly is short in service life, and potential safety hazards exist in use of a driver are solved.

A well-sealed, internally-pierced closure body and a packaging container having the same

The present application belongs to the technical field of product packaging, and particularly relates to a well-sealed inner-piercing cover body and a packaging container with the same. In the fields of food, medicine or cosmetics, two or more components are often packaged separately to avoid chemical reaction or quality decline during long-term storage and transportation. The present application can simply and quickly mix and blend two independently sealed materials together. The cover body is used to contain a first material, and a packaging container contains a second material. The cover body is assembled on the packaging container through threaded connection. The cover body comprises a main cover, a secondary cover and a piercing member. The main cover is connected with the bottle body through threads. The piercing member is arranged in the main cover. The secondary cover is arranged on the upper part of the main cover and the piercing member. The present application can conveniently mix as needed, provide more convenient use experience, effectively avoid cross contamination, and has a lightweight structure design, which is suitable for travel and outdoor use, and airtight structure ensures hygiene during storage.

Lower control arm of double-fork-arm front suspension

The utility model discloses a lower control arm of a double-fork-arm front suspension, which comprises a control arm body, the control arm body is of a cavity structure formed by buckling and welding an upper plate and a lower plate, and a first extension end, a second extension end and a third extension end of the control arm body are respectively used for connecting a front bushing, a rear bushing and a ball pin assembly; the damping support assembly comprises a damping inner plate, a damping outer plate and a mounting nut, the damping inner plate is embedded in the cavity structure and welded to the inner wall of the upper plate and the inner wall of the lower plate, the damping outer plate is arranged on the outer side of the upper plate and welded to the upper plate, and the mounting nut is fixed to the side, back to the damping outer plate, of the damping inner plate; through holes are formed in the areas, right opposite to the damping inner plate, of the upper plate and the lower plate, a damper mounting channel is formed between the damping inner plate and the damping outer plate, and mounting through holes used for bolt connection are formed in the damping inner plate and the damping outer plate in a right opposite mode. The mounting function integration of the shock absorber can be realized, and the requirements of light weight and structural reinforcement are met.
